Transaction 21f0910a36093fde7e3f24450706d2287a0555c95dd58c2a00efd3f89958be55
1 Input
1 Output
-
21f0910a36093fde7e3f24450706d2287a0555c95dd58c2a00efd3f89958be55:0
- value
- 38799789
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5037837ca2733b6eb45723522c6f394bf5731e0f OP_EQUAL
- address
- 391AV3Wp9HpNo7hS7aaWY5G6j6BEdvkeoV